Mary Campbell Ward's Obituary
Mary Campbell Ward, 85, of Culpeper passed away on Wednesday, March 26, 2014 after a long struggle with Alzheimer’s. She was born June 12, 1928 in Springfield, MA.
Mrs. Ward worked as Coordinator for volunteers and candy stripers at Bradley Memorial Hospital in Southington, CT before her move to Culpeper where she worked admissions for Germanna Community College. After her retirement, she volunteered for the Culpeper Regional Hospital Auxiliary alongside her fellow Pink Ladies. She was a member of Hopewell United Methodist Church where she was active in the Share and Care ministry.
